Caracch, explaining to the newspaper Hespress, added that “Al -Nina” is a reverse position for what the Moroccan and semi -Iberian atmosphere lived (formerly since 2018), meaning that the water of the surface oceans is cooler, which weakens the energy feeding of the pressure of the photos; This allows the infiltration of cold air masses from the Scandinavian region, as well as from Canada after cutting the Atlantic Ocean.
The same climate expert did not rule out a “high possibility of these rains continuing throughout the spring this year; Because it is a climatic situation that extends in time and affects the major air cycle in the northern part of the globe, ”recalling that“ the drought that Morocco lived since 2018 was in its greatest premium due to the stability of the Nyneho phenomenon in the Pacific Ocean (surface waters warmer than usual), which made the concentration of the pressure of the pictorial in a place that prevents the arrival of the turmoil. ”

Muhammad bin Abbou, an environmental engineer, an expert in the field of climate and water, said that “the return of the phenomenon of Ninea to Morocco remains very possible, and it is – as it is known – comes with a clear effect on the climate of the globe; That is, it contributes to cooling the atmosphere, unlike the ‘Ninho’ phenomenon, which is influencing a high temperature, while increasing global warming; This is what we recorded during the past years in Morocco (especially in the year 2024, and its heaty folded).
